Ritorno al futuro - This vintage JVC GR-C1 was famous as Doc Brown's video camera in the film - with original case

Collectors item. The JVC GR-C1 was famous as Doc Brown's video camera (operated by Marty McFly) in the film Back to the Future. (It also appeared in Stranger Things season 2 (set in 1984), as the camcorder Bob Newby gives Jonathan Byers to use when he takes Will and the other kids trick-or-treating, and is used to record the Mind Flayer.) The JVC GR-C1 was the subject of an episode of Marques Brownlee's YouTube Originals series "Retro Tech."
